Effective Stress Management Strategies for Men: A Holistic Approach

Stress, a ubiquitous aspect of modern life, significantly impacts men’s physical and psychological well-being. This article explores effective stress management techniques grounded in psychological and physiological principles, focusing on practical applications to enhance men’s resilience and overall health. Key concepts such as self-efficacy, social support, and allostatic load will be examined within the context of evidence-based strategies.

1. Cultivating Self-Efficacy and Proactive Coping: Self-efficacy, the belief in one’s ability to succeed in specific situations, is crucial for stress management. Setting achievable goals, a cornerstone of goal-setting theory, empowers men to break down overwhelming tasks into manageable steps. This proactive approach minimizes feelings of being overwhelmed, fostering a sense of control and accomplishment. For example, instead of aiming for a massive career advancement in one year, a man could set smaller, incremental goals, such as completing a specific project each quarter, thereby building confidence and reducing stress related to unattainable expectations.

2. Prioritizing Holistic Well-being: A holistic approach to well-being encompasses physical, psychological, and social dimensions. Maintaining a balanced diet, regular exercise, and sufficient sleep are crucial, aligning with principles of health psychology. Regular physical activity, for instance, helps regulate the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is, reducing the body’s physiological response to stress. Furthermore, adequate sleep is vital for cognitive function and emotional regulation, mitigating the negative impact of chronic stress on mental well-being. This strategy can be conceptualized as the foundation upon which other stress management techniques build, ensuring a robust defense against stress.

3. Leveraging Social Support Networks: Social support, a core tenet of social support theory, plays a pivotal role in stress management. Actively cultivating and maintaining strong relationships with friends, family, and colleagues provides emotional buffer against stress. Seeking guidance and support from trusted individuals or joining support groups can significantly enhance coping mechanisms and improve overall mental health. The concept of social capital demonstrates the importance of strong social ties in reducing feelings of isolation and promoting resilience in the face of adversity.

4. Mastering Mindfulness and Relaxation Techniques: Mindfulness-based stress reduction (MBSR) techniques promote present moment awareness, decreasing rumination and anxiety. Deep breathing exercises and meditation help regulate the autonomic nervous system, reducing physiological responses to stress, such as increased heart rate and cortisol levels. This can be applied practically through daily mindfulness practices, such as dedicated meditation sessions or incorporating mindful moments throughout the day to improve focus and manage emotional reactivity.

5. Establishing Healthy Boundaries and Time Management: Effective time management, aligning with principles of organizational behavior, enables prioritization of tasks and prevents stress from overload. Learning to say “no” to additional commitments when necessary promotes healthy boundaries, preventing burnout. Implementing time-blocking techniques or utilizing productivity tools can enhance efficiency and prevent the accumulation of tasks leading to stress and decreased well-being. This fosters a sense of control over one’s time and energy, significantly contributing to stress reduction.

6. Cognitive Restructuring and Positive Self-Talk: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) principles highlight the importance of challenging negative thought patterns and replacing them with positive self-talk. This involves identifying cognitive distortions—irrational or inaccurate thoughts that amplify stress—and reframing them into more realistic and constructive perspectives. Regular positive self-affirmations reinforce self-confidence and resilience, contributing to better stress coping mechanisms.

7. Digital Detoxification and Technology Management: Excessive technology use contributes to stress and sleep disturbances. Regular breaks from screens, disconnecting from work emails outside working hours, and limiting social media exposure are crucial for promoting mental well-being. This strategy aligns with research on the effects of technology overuse and its impact on psychological health.

8. Utilizing Humor and Social Engagement: Humor serves as a powerful stress reliever, releasing endorphins and improving mood. Spending time with loved ones, engaging in enjoyable activities, or participating in social events fosters positive emotions and reduces feelings of isolation, aligning with research on the benefits of social interaction on mental and physical health. This reinforces the importance of social connection in overall well-being.

9. Seeking Professional Help: When stress becomes unmanageable, seeking professional help is crucial. Therapists and counselors provide tailored support, utilizing evidence-based therapeutic approaches such as CBT or mindfulness-based interventions to equip men with effective coping strategies. Recognizing the limitations of self-management and seeking professional guidance demonstrates self-awareness and proactive commitment to mental health.

Maintaining Optimal Dermal Health: A Comprehensive Guide for Men

This article presents a holistic approach to male skincare, integrating established dermatological principles and practices to achieve and maintain healthy skin. Key concepts discussed include the skin’s barrier function (its protective layer against environmental stressors), the importance of cellular turnover (the natural process of shedding dead skin cells), and the role of intrinsic and extrinsic aging factors (internal and external influences on skin aging). We will explore the application of these concepts in a practical, step-by-step skincare regimen.

  1. Derma Cleansing and Exfoliation: Maintaining optimal skin health begins with daily cleansing to remove sebum, environmental pollutants, and dead skin cells. This process is crucial for preventing pore blockage and subsequent acne development, in accordance with principles of comedogenesis (the formation of comedones, or blackheads and whiteheads). Gentle, pH-balanced cleansers should be employed, followed by regular exfoliation (1-2 times per week) to promote cellular turnover. Exfoliation, whether physical (scrubs) or chemical (AHAs/BHAs), aids in removing the stratum corneum (the outermost skin layer), revealing brighter, smoother skin. Choosing exfoliants appropriate for individual skin type and sensitivity is paramount to avoid irritation.
  2. Hydration and Barrier Support: Maintaining adequate hydration is critical for preserving the skin’s barrier function. This involves both topical hydration (through the application of moisturizers suited to skin type) and systemic hydration (drinking sufficient water). Moisturizers work by replenishing the skin’s natural moisturizing factors (NMFs) and creating a protective barrier against transepidermal water loss (TEWL). The selection of moisturizer should consider individual skin type, whether oily, dry, combination, or sensitive, to optimize hydration and avoid further complications.
  3. Photoprotection: Ultraviolet (UV) radiation is a significant extrinsic factor contributing to premature aging (photoaging) and skin cancer. Daily application of a broad-spectrum sunscreen with a minimum Sun Protection Factor (SPF) of 30 is essential to mitigate these risks. This acts as a preventative measure against the damage caused by both UVA and UVB rays, effectively reducing the likelihood of long-term damage and promoting healthier aging.
  4. Nutritional and Lifestyle Considerations: A balanced diet rich in antioxidants (found in fruits and vegetables), vitamins (particularly A, C, and E), and essential fatty acids supports healthy skin function from within. Furthermore, adequate sleep (7-9 hours) is crucial, as skin repair and regeneration primarily occur during sleep. Reducing stress through relaxation techniques (meditation, yoga, or exercise) also plays a vital role, as chronic stress can exacerbate skin conditions such as acne and rosacea.
  5. Shaving Practices and Hygiene: Proper shaving technique, using a sharp razor and lubricating shaving gel, minimizes irritation and ingrown hairs. Maintaining good hygiene practices, including frequent handwashing, particularly before touching the face, helps prevent the transfer of bacteria and reduces the risk of infection. These practices are aligned with general principles of infection control, reducing the likelihood of secondary skin conditions.
  6. Product Selection and Professional Consultation: Selecting skincare products appropriate for individual skin type and concerns is vital. Reading ingredient labels and avoiding harsh chemicals or potential irritants is crucial to avoid adverse reactions. Consulting a dermatologist or skincare professional allows for personalized recommendations and addresses specific concerns (e.g., acne, hyperpigmentation, or aging). This approach aligns with the principles of personalized medicine, delivering optimized skincare solutions.
  7. Regular Skin Examinations: Regular self-skin exams and periodic visits to a dermatologist for professional skin checks are essential for early detection of skin cancer and other potential issues. Early detection significantly improves treatment outcomes and reduces the impact of severe skin pathologies. This is particularly important given the increased incidence of skin cancer in recent years.
  8. Lip Care and Avoidance of Harmful Habits: Lip health should not be overlooked. Utilizing lip balms with SPF protection safeguards against sun damage and dryness. Avoiding smoking and excessive alcohol consumption, which are known to contribute to premature aging and skin damage, is also crucial for maintaining optimal skin health. These practices align with a holistic approach to well-being, emphasizing preventive measures.

The Role of Antioxidants in Protecting Your Body

The Role of Antioxidants in Protecting Your Body

Hey there, lovely readers! It’s AckySHINE here, and today I want to talk to you about the incredible role of antioxidants in protecting your body. 🌟

  1. First and foremost, let’s talk about what antioxidants actually are. Antioxidants are substances that can help prevent or slow down damage to our cells caused by harmful molecules called free radicals. They work like superheroes, neutralizing these free radicals and keeping our bodies healthy and vibrant. 💪

  2. Antioxidants are found in many delicious foods, such as berries, dark chocolate, green tea, and even red wine! So as AckySHINE, I highly recommend incorporating these goodies into your diet for a daily dose of antioxidant power. 🍓🍫🍵🍷

  3. One of the key benefits of antioxidants is their ability to fight oxidative stress. This occurs when there is an imbalance between free radicals and antioxidants in the body. Oxidative stress has been linked to various diseases, including heart disease, cancer, and neurodegenerative disorders. By boosting our antioxidant intake, we can help combat this harmful process. 🚫❌

  4. Did you know that antioxidants can also play a role in skin health? As AckySHINE, I advise you to look for skincare products that contain antioxidants, as they can help protect your skin from damage caused by environmental factors like UV rays and pollution. You’ll be glowing in no time! ✨🌞🌿

  5. Another fantastic benefit of antioxidants is their potential to boost our immune system. By reducing oxidative stress and inflammation, antioxidants can help strengthen our body’s defenses and keep those pesky colds away. 🤧🌡️💪

  6. Antioxidants have also been linked to better eye health. For example, the antioxidant vitamins C and E, as well as the carotenoids lutein and zeaxanthin, have been shown to reduce the risk of age-related macular degeneration and cataracts. So don’t forget to munch on those carrots and leafy greens to keep your peepers in tip-top shape! 👀🥕🌿

  7. Some studies have even suggested that antioxidants may have anti-cancer properties. Although more research is needed, incorporating antioxidant-rich foods into your diet may help lower your risk of certain types of cancer. It’s always better to be safe than sorry, right? 🎗️🍎🍇

  8. As AckySHINE, I recommend practicing moderation when it comes to antioxidant supplements. While they may seem like a quick fix, it’s important to remember that whole foods are the best sources of antioxidants. So make sure to fill your plate with a colorful array of fruits, veggies, and whole grains! 🍉🥦🍞

  9. Remember, antioxidants work best as a team. They have a synergistic effect, meaning that they work together to provide even greater protection against free radicals. So don’t rely on just one antioxidant source – mix it up and enjoy a variety of antioxidant-rich foods! 🍓🥑🥬

  10. It’s also important to note that different antioxidants have different functions in the body. For example, vitamin C is water-soluble and works in the watery parts of our cells, while vitamin E is fat-soluble and protects the cell membranes. By consuming a balanced diet, we can ensure that we’re getting a diverse range of antioxidants to support overall health. 💦🌰🧪

  11. Adding a sprinkle of spice to your meals can also give you an antioxidant boost. Turmeric, for instance, contains a powerful antioxidant called curcumin, which has been shown to have numerous health benefits, including reducing inflammation and improving brain function. So go ahead, spice things up! 🌶️🍛🧠

  12. Antioxidants can be a real game-changer when it comes to aging gracefully. By fighting off free radicals, they can help slow down the aging process and keep our skin looking youthful and radiant. Who wouldn’t want that? 🌷👵🌟

  13. As AckySHINE, I recommend pairing antioxidant-rich foods with sources of healthy fats. This is because some antioxidants, like beta-carotene, are fat-soluble and are better absorbed when consumed with a little bit of fat. So drizzle some olive oil on your salad or enjoy a handful of nuts with your berries for maximum benefit! 🥗🥜💚

  14. It’s important to remember that a balanced lifestyle is key. While antioxidants are fantastic for our health, they are not a magical cure-all. So make sure to also prioritize other aspects of wellness, such as regular exercise, stress management, and quality sleep. Your body will thank you! 💤💪🌈

Embracing Prudent Financial Management: A Strategic Approach to Wealth Creation

This article explores the principles of effective personal finance management, providing a structured framework for achieving financial well-being. We will analyze key concepts such as budgeting, saving, investing, and debt management, illustrating their practical applications using real-world examples and referencing relevant financial theories and models. The ultimate aim is to equip individuals with the knowledge and skills necessary to develop robust financial habits and build long-term financial security. Key concepts such as behavioral economics, Modern Portfolio Theory (MPT), and the significance of credit scoring will be defined and applied throughout the discussion.

1. Goal Setting and Financial Planning: A foundational element of successful financial management is establishing clear,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) financial goals. This involves outlining short-term, mid-term, and long-term objectives—such as purchasing a home, funding higher education, or planning for retirement. Employing financial planning tools, such as discounted cash flow analysis or future value calculations, enables individuals to project future financial needs and design effective strategies to meet them. Goal-setting theory emphasizes the crucial role of clearly defined objectives in enhancing motivation, focus, and resource allocation towards achieving desired financial outcomes. For instance, setting a specific savings goal for a down payment on a house, coupled with a timeline, motivates consistent saving behavior.

2. Budgetary Control and Resource Allocation: Effective budgetary control forms the cornerstone of sound financial management. This involves meticulously tracking income and expenses, leveraging budgeting software or spreadsheets to categorize expenditures and identify areas for potential cost reduction. Behavioral economics highlights the influence of cognitive biases on financial decision-making; conscious monitoring of spending patterns allows for curbing impulsive purchases and aligning spending with pre-defined financial goals. The 50/30/20 budgeting rule – allocating 50% of income to needs, 30% to wants, and 20% to savings and debt repayment – provides a practical framework for resource allocation, emphasizing prioritization and mindful spending.

3. Strategic Savings and Investment Planning: Building a robust savings plan is paramount for long-term financial security. This involves consistently setting aside a predetermined portion of income, ideally automating transfers to dedicated savings accounts. Diversification of savings across various instruments, such as high-yield savings accounts, money market funds, and certificates of deposit, optimizes returns while mitigating risk. Furthermore, incorporating investment strategies is crucial for wealth creation. Understanding portfolio diversification and asset allocation principles, considering risk tolerance and time horizons, allows for selecting appropriate investment vehicles, including stocks, bonds, and real estate. Modern Portfolio Theory (MPT) provides a framework for optimizing portfolio construction, balancing risk and return to align with individual investor profiles.

4. Debt Management and Financial Risk Mitigation: Effective debt management is crucial for maintaining financial health. Differentiating between “good” debt (e.g., mortgages, student loans) and “bad” debt (e.g., high-interest credit card debt) is essential. Prioritizing the repayment of high-interest debt using strategies like the debt avalanche or snowball method minimizes financial burden and interest accrual. Credit scoring models, such as the FICO score, illustrate how debt management significantly impacts creditworthiness and access to favorable financial products. A healthy credit score is vital for securing loans at competitive interest rates and accessing other financial services, thereby reducing the overall cost of borrowing.

5. Prudent Consumption and Avoiding Impulsive Spending: Distinguishing between needs and wants is fundamental to effective financial management. Mindful spending necessitates resisting impulsive purchases and prioritizing essential expenses over discretionary ones. Behavioral economics principles underscore the need to address cognitive biases influencing consumer behavior. Employing techniques such as delayed gratification and the “sleep-on-it” approach can significantly reduce impulsive spending and enhance financial discipline, leading to greater savings and investment opportunities.

6. Emergency Preparedness and Risk Management: Creating an emergency fund is critical for mitigating the financial impact of unforeseen events. Aiming for three to six months’ worth of living expenses in an easily accessible account provides a financial safety net during periods of unemployment or unexpected medical expenses. This exemplifies a key aspect of risk management, protecting against financial vulnerability and improving overall resilience. A robust emergency fund reduces reliance on high-interest debt during crises, preventing further financial strain.

7. Financial Literacy and Continuous Learning: Continuous learning about personal finance is essential for informed decision-making. This involves seeking knowledge from credible sources—such as reputable books, workshops, and financial advisors—to gain a comprehensive understanding of financial concepts, investment strategies, and risk management techniques. This aligns with human capital theory, recognizing that investing in personal knowledge enhances decision-making capabilities and improves financial outcomes. Staying abreast of market trends and regulatory changes is vital for adapting financial strategies effectively.

8. Seeking Professional Financial Guidance: Consulting a qualified financial advisor provides access to personalized guidance tailored to individual circumstances. Financial advisors offer expertise in diverse areas—such as investment management, retirement planning, and estate planning—enabling the development of customized strategies aligned with specific financial needs and goals. This is particularly beneficial for individuals lacking the time or expertise to manage their finances independently.

9. Regular Financial Monitoring and Review: Continuously monitoring financial progress is crucial for effective management. Regularly reviewing budgets, investment portfolios, and debt levels ensures the financial plan remains aligned with goals and adapts to evolving circumstances. This allows for timely identification and correction of any deviations from the established plan, optimizing the achievement of financial objectives. This proactive approach prevents minor issues from escalating into major financial problems.

10. Avoiding Comparative Spending and Focusing on Personal Goals: Resisting the pressure to emulate others’ lifestyles is essential for avoiding unnecessary expenses. Focusing on personal financial goals rather than engaging in comparative spending fosters financial independence and reduces the risk of overspending. This is a core principle in achieving financial well-being, highlighting the significance of self-directed financial planning and prioritizing individual aspirations over external pressures.

Unlock Your Fat-Burning Potential with 20-Minute HIIT Workouts

Achieving rapid and efficient fat loss is a common fitness goal, and High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T) offers a powerful solution. As a fitness expert, I can confidently say that incorporating 20-minute HIIT workouts into your routine can deliver remarkable results. This dynamic approach to exercise maximizes calorie expenditure and boosts overall fitness within a remarkably short timeframe. Let’s explore the transformative power of 20-minute HIIT workouts.

HIIT’s effectiveness stems from its alternating cycles of intense bursts of exercise followed by brief recovery periods. This cyclical pattern elevates your heart rate significantly, leading to substantial calorie burning and efficient fat loss. This method surpasses many traditional workout approaches in its effectiveness for fat reduction.

One of the key advantages of HIIT is its remarkable flexibility. You can perform these workouts virtually anywhere—at home, in a park, or even while traveling. All you need is a timer, a small amount of space, and the commitment to push yourself. This accessibility makes HIIT an ideal choice for those with busy schedules or limited access to gym facilities.

A typical 20-minute HIIT workout might integrate dynamic exercises such as burpees, mountain climbers, squats, and jumping jacks. These compound movements engage multiple muscle groups simultaneously, maximizing calorie expenditure and boosting overall metabolic rate. This full-body engagement ensures you’re working harder and burning more calories than with isolated exercises.

The beauty of HIIT lies in its adaptability to different fitness levels. Begin with shorter intervals and gradually increase the duration and intensity as your fitness improves. Remember, the key is to challenge yourself while carefully listening to your body’s signals. This progressive approach ensures sustainable progress and reduces the risk of injury.

HIIT’s remarkable fat-burning capabilities are further enhanced by the “afterburn effect,” also known as Excess Post-exercise Oxygen Consumption (EPOC). This post-workout metabolic elevation continues burning calories for hours, effectively extending the fat-burning benefits beyond your training session. Think of it as a metabolic boost that helps you achieve your fitness goals even when you’re resting.

Beyond the immediate calorie burn, HIIT significantly boosts your metabolism. This elevated metabolic rate translates into increased fat burning even during periods of rest. Essentially, HIIT provides a sustained fat-burning engine, helping you shed unwanted pounds even after you’ve finished your workout.

Research supports HIIT’s effectiveness in targeting abdominal fat. A study published in the Journal of Obesity demonstrated that HIIT was superior to other exercise forms in reducing belly fat. This targeted fat reduction makes HIIT a highly effective strategy for those seeking to tone their midsection.

The advantages of HIIT extend beyond fat loss. It significantly improves cardiovascular health by demanding more from your heart and lungs. This enhanced aerobic capacity translates into improved stamina and easier performance of everyday tasks. Investing in your cardiovascular health is an investment in overall well-being.

HIIT’s time efficiency is a major selling point for busy individuals. A mere 20 minutes can deliver a comprehensive full-body workout, leaving you feeling energized and accomplished. Maximize your workout efficiency and minimize time commitment with this powerful training method.

For optimal results, incorporate HIIT into your routine 3-4 times per week, allowing at least one rest day between sessions for recovery and muscle repair. Consistency is paramount to achieving and maintaining your fitness objectives. Remember that rest is an active part of the recovery process.

If you’re new to HIIT, start with shorter, more manageable intervals. A good starting point could be 20 seconds of high-intensity work followed by 40 seconds of rest. Gradually increase the duration and intensity of your intervals as you become more accustomed to the demands of the workout. Listen to your body and adjust accordingly.

Maintaining proper form is crucial throughout your HIIT workouts. Correct technique ensures optimal results while reducing the risk of injuries. If you’re uncertain about proper form, consult a certified fitness professional or utilize online instructional videos to guide you.

For amplified fat-burning benefits, combine HIIT with strength training. Strength training builds lean muscle mass, which further increases your metabolism and boosts fat burn. This synergistic approach optimizes your results and enhances your overall fitness level.

Diabetes Management: Balancing Blood Sugar Levels

Diabetes Management: Balancing Blood Sugar Levels

📝 As AckySHINE, I am here to share my expert advice on diabetes management and how to effectively balance blood sugar levels. Diabetes is a chronic condition that affects millions of people worldwide, and proper management is key to maintaining good health and preventing complications. By following some simple strategies and making lifestyle changes, you can take control of your diabetes and lead a vibrant, fulfilling life.

1️⃣ Understand your condition: Education is the foundation of effective diabetes management. Learn about the different types of diabetes, the role of insulin, and how your body processes sugar. This knowledge will empower you to make informed decisions about your health.

2️⃣ Eat a balanced diet: A healthy diet is crucial for managing blood sugar levels. Focus on consuming a variety of nutrient-rich foods, including f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ats. Avoid sugary drinks and processed foods, as they can cause your blood sugar levels to spike. Instead, opt for foods with a low glycemic index, such as berries, leafy greens, and legumes.

3️⃣ Monitor your blood sugar: Regularly check your blood sugar levels to track how your body is responding to different foods and activities. This will help you understand the impact of certain foods on your blood sugar and make necessary adjustments to your diet and medication.

4️⃣ Be physically active: Engaging in regular physical activity is beneficial for everyone, but especially for those with diabetes. Exercise helps your body use insulin more efficiently, lowers blood sugar levels, and improves overall cardiovascular health.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ise, such as brisk walking or cycling, most days of the week.

5️⃣ Medication management: If you have been prescribed medication to manage your diabetes, it is essential to take it as prescribed. Follow your healthcare provider’s instructions and never skip doses. If you have concerns or experience side effects, discuss them with your doctor.

6️⃣ Stay hydrated: Adequate hydration is crucial for maintaining stable blood sugar levels. Make sure to drink plenty of water throughout the day and limit your intake of sugary or caffeinated beverages. Water helps your body flush out toxins and keeps you feeling energized.

7️⃣ Stress management: Chronic stress can have a negative impact on blood sugar levels. Find healthy ways to manage stress, such as practicing meditation, deep breathing exercises, or engaging in hobbies that bring you joy. Taking care of your mental health is just as important as managing your physical health.

8️⃣ Get enough sleep: Quality sleep is vital for overall health, including blood sugar management. Aim for 7-9 hours of uninterrupted sleep each night. Establish a bedtime routine, create a comfortable sleep environment, and limit screen time before bed to ensure a good night’s rest.

9️⃣ Support system: Build a strong support system of family, friends, and healthcare professionals who understand and support your diabetes management goals. Having someone to talk to, share experiences with, and seek advice from can make a world of difference.

🔟 Regular check-ups: Stay on top of your health by scheduling regular check-ups with your healthcare provider. They will monitor your blood sugar levels, assess your overall health, and make any necessary adjustments to your treatment plan.

Navigating Organizational Transformation: A Strategic Framework for Embracing Change and Driving Growth

Organizational change, a pervasive phenomenon influencing both internal operations and external competitiveness, frequently encounters resistance. However, proactive change management offers substantial opportunities for improved organizational performance and sustainable growth. This article examines fifteen strategic approaches, grounded in established organizational behavior theories, to effectively manage resistance and foster a dynamic environment of adaptation and progress. Key concepts, including organizational change management (defined as the structured process of guiding individuals and organizations through transitions), resistance to change (encompassing individual and collective opposition to planned alterations), and transformational leadership (characterized by inspiring vision and fostering follower development), will be explored throughout this analysis.

1. Aligning Change with Organizational Vision and Strategic Goals: Before initiating change, a clear articulation of the initiative’s connection to the overarching organizational vision and strategic objectives is paramount. This strategic alignment ensures that the change is perceived as purposeful and relevant, fostering greater employee buy-in and reducing resistance. This directly addresses the core tenets of strategic management, ensuring that change initiatives are not isolated events but integral parts of a broader strategic plan. For example, a company aiming for digital transformation should explicitly link all related changes to their overarching goal of improved customer engagement and operational efficiency.

2. Diagnostic Assessment of Resistance: A thorough pre-change assessment, employing methodologies such as surveys, interviews, and focus groups, is crucial. This helps identify the root causes of potential resistance—fear of the unknown (as highlighted in Lewin’s Change Management Model), job security concerns, or cultural inertia—allowing for targeted interventions. For instance, if the assessment reveals widespread fear of job displacement, the intervention could involve transparent communication about reskilling initiatives and opportunities for career development within the new structure.

3. Articulating a Compelling Vision and Benefits: Effective communication is pivotal. The change initiative should be framed within a compelling vision, highlighting its strategic significance and aligning it with organizational goals. Demonstrating tangible benefits—increased efficiency, improved productivity, enhanced employee well-being, and professional growth opportunities—is crucial. This leverages expectancy theory, which posits that motivation is influenced by the belief that effort will lead to performance and subsequent rewards. For example, clearly outlining how a new process will reduce workload and free up time for more strategic tasks directly benefits employees.

4. Exemplary Leadership and Role Modeling: Transformational leadership, characterized by inspiring vision and empowering followers, is critical. Leaders must actively model the desired behaviors, visibly embracing new ideas, participating in training, and actively implementing new processes. This resonates with social learning theory, which emphasizes the impact of observational learning on behavior. If senior management visibly utilizes the new software, it encourages adoption among other employees.

5. Collaborative Change Management and Stakeholder Engagement: Involving stakeholders in decision-making fosters a sense of ownership. This participatory approach, consistent with stakeholder theory, ensures that individuals feel valued and are active participants, rather than passive recipients of change. For example, establishing a steering committee with representatives from various departments can ensure diverse perspectives are considered during the change implementation process.

6. Phased Implementation and Incremental Change: Implementing change incrementally, as suggested by Kotter’s 8-Step Change Model, reduces resistance by minimizing disruption. Breaking down large-scale change into smaller, manageable steps allows for continuous feedback, adaptation, and smoother transition. For example, instead of launching a complete ERP system at once, a phased approach might involve introducing modules sequentially.

7. Proactive Communication and Addressing Concerns: Open and honest communication, actively addressing employee concerns, providing reassurance, and establishing open dialogue channels are vital. This builds trust and reduces anxiety. This is consistent with effective communication management principles. For example, regular town hall meetings or Q&A sessions can help address misinformation and build transparency.

8. Comprehensive Support and Resource Allocation: Successful change necessitates substantial investment in employee support: comprehensive training, readily available resources, and mentorship. This addresses anxieties, reduces isolation, and aligns with resource dependence theory, which underscores the importance of resources in navigating change. For example, providing access to online learning platforms and assigning experienced mentors can significantly aid employee adaptation.

9. Fostering a Culture of Continuous Learning and Development: Cultivating a learning culture promotes adaptability. This involves implementing learning initiatives, encouraging experimentation, and rewarding learning efforts. This is in line with positive organizational scholarship, emphasizing the development of positive organizational attributes. Implementing regular training sessions and celebrating successful adaptations foster a learning-oriented environment.

10. Recognition, Reward, and Reinforcement: Acknowledging and rewarding milestones reinforces positive behavior. This involves formal and informal recognition and consistent reinforcement, leveraging operant conditioning principles. For example, publicly acknowledging early adopters and rewarding successful implementation of new processes can significantly boost morale and motivate further participation.

11. Continuous Feedback Mechanisms and Iterative Improvement: Regular feedback enables course corrections. This iterative approach ensures the change remains aligned with organizational needs and employee experiences, promoting continuous improvement. For example, collecting feedback through surveys and focus groups allows for adjustments to the change strategy as needed.

12. Adaptability and Contingency Planning: Organizations must remain flexible. Contingency planning addresses potential disruptions and maintains momentum. This reflects the importance of dynamic capabilities, the ability to adapt and change in response to environmental shifts. Having alternative plans in place to address unexpected challenges is crucial.

13. Resource Provision and Skill Enhancement: Equipping employees with the necessary skills and knowledge through training and support is crucial. This aligns with human capital theory, emphasizing investment in employee capabilities. For example, investing in specialized training programs ensures that employees possess the skills necessary to succeed in the changed environment.

14. Creating a Psychologically Safe Environment: Fostering a culture where employees feel safe expressing concerns is vital. This encourages open communication and collaboration, contributing to improved outcomes. This is closely linked to the research on organizational climate and culture. Implementing mechanisms for anonymous feedback can encourage open communication without fear of reprisal.

15. Maintaining a Positive and Optimistic Outlook: A positive leadership approach inspires resilience. Leaders expressing confidence and highlighting benefits enhance morale and encourage participation, aligning with positive psychology principles in organizational settings. Regular communication emphasizing the positive aspects of the change and celebrating successes can significantly impact overall morale.

Exercise and Disease Prevention: A Holistic Approach to Health Enhancement

Introduction: This article examines the multifaceted role of regular physical activity in preventing chronic diseases and optimizing overall well-being. We will explore the physiological and psychological mechanisms by which exercise exerts its protective effects, utilizing established models from exercise physiology, behavioral science, and public health. Central to our discussion are key concepts: the allostatic load, representing the cumulative physiological burden from chronic stress; the biopsychosocial model, emphasizing the interplay of biological, psychological, and social factors in health; and the dose-response relationship in exercise, highlighting the importance of intensity, duration, and frequency in achieving beneficial outcomes. Understanding these concepts is vital for effectively applying exercise interventions to improve health outcomes.

1. Cardiovascular Health: Regular exercise significantly reduces cardiovascular disease (CVD) risk. Aerobic exercise strengthens the myocardium, improves contractility, enhances vascular function, and optimizes lipid profiles. This aligns with cardiac rehabilitation principles and demonstrates a clear dose-response relationship between physical activity and reduced CVD mortality. These improvements directly decrease the risk of atherosclerosis and hypertension.

2. Metabolic Regulation and Diabetes: Exercise plays a pivotal role in preventing type 2 diabetes mellitus by enhancing insulin sensitivity through increased skeletal muscle glucose uptake, improving glycemic control. This mechanism is fundamental to diabetes management. Weight management, often facilitated by exercise, further reduces insulin resistance. Interventions based on exercise demonstrate effectiveness in both preventing and managing this condition.

3. Immunological Function: Moderate exercise strengthens the immune system by increasing natural killer cell and cytokine production, improving the body’s infection-fighting capabilities and potentially reducing certain cancer risks. The principle of hormesis, where moderate stress elicits beneficial adaptations, is applicable here. However, excessive exercise can transiently suppress immunity, emphasizing the need for a balanced approach.

4. Musculoskeletal Health: Weight-bearing exercise is crucial for maintaining bone mineral density and muscle strength, mitigating osteoporosis and sarcopenia risks. These activities stimulate bone remodeling and increase muscle mass, improving functional capacity and reducing fracture risk. This directly counters the age-related decline in musculoskeletal function, preserving mobility and independence.

5. Cancer Risk: While mechanisms are still under investigation, evidence links regular physical activity to a reduced risk of several cancers. Exercise may influence hormone levels, reduce inflammation, and enhance immune surveillance, potentially inhibiting cancer cell proliferation. This aligns with the understanding of inflammation and immune system roles in cancer development.

6. Mental Health and Well-being: Exercise offers substantial mental health benefits. Endorphin release elevates mood, while reduced cortisol levels mitigate chronic stress, improving psychological well-being. This reflects the biopsychosocial model, demonstrating the physical-mental health link. Cognitive improvements, such as enhanced attention and memory, are also observed.

7. Weight Management and Metabolic Syndrome: Exercise significantly contributes to weight management by increasing energy expenditure and improving metabolism. It’s a cornerstone of interventions targeting metabolic syndrome, a cluster of risk factors for CVD and type 2 diabetes. Combining exercise with balanced nutrition maximizes sustainable weight loss and metabolic improvement.

8. Sleep Quality: Regular exercise enhances sleep quality by regulating the circadian rhythm and reducing stress. Avoiding intense exercise before bed is crucial. This reflects the interplay between physical activity and sleep homeostasis.

9. Cognitive Function: Exercise promotes neurogenesis and cerebral blood flow, improving cognitive function, memory, and attention. These effects are particularly beneficial in mitigating age-related cognitive decline.

10. Chronic Pain: Exercise plays a significant role in managing chronic pain by reducing inflammation, improving muscle strength and flexibility, and enhancing functional capacity, leading to pain relief and improved quality of life. Exercise programs should be tailored to individual conditions, with low-impact options often preferred.

11. Digestion and Gut Health: Regular physical activity improves gut motility and bowel function, promoting better digestion and reducing gastrointestinal problems. This aligns with the growing understanding of the gut-brain axis.

12. Energy Levels: Regular exercise paradoxically boosts energy levels long-term by improving cardiovascular fitness and reducing fatigue, promoting sustained vitality.

13. Stroke Risk Reduction: Exercise lowers blood pressure, improves blood flow, and facilitates healthy weight management, significantly reducing stroke risk, consistent with established stroke risk factors.

14. Longevity: Studies strongly correlate regular exercise with increased life expectancy, primarily due to reduced chronic disease risk and improved physiological function.

15. Holistic Well-being: Exercise fosters holistic well-being, enhancing self-esteem, reducing stress, improving mood, increasing productivity, and elevating overall quality of life. It positively impacts numerous aspects of human existence.
